![]() | ![]() The HD3850 is an interesting card in the grand scheme of ATI's lineup and Diamond's 512MB version of the card is also interesting in that the card lies right in the middle of the 3850 to HD3870 price range. The price for this card online is $199.99, on Diamond's website and $179.99 at the lowest price available, which is $10 more than the 256MB version of this card. Compared to its lower memory sibling, the 256MB HD3850, a 512MB 3850 provides more performance for just a little more money. The 3850 from Diamond comes default clocked, meaning that the performance increase only comes from the extra memory on the card. http://www.gamepyre.com/hardwared.html?aid=929&p=1
